NGL Energy Partners LP Announces First Quarter 2016 Results
August 10, 2015 7:00 AM EDTTULSA, Okla.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- NGL Energy Partners LP (NYSE: NGL) today reported Adjusted EBITDA of $89.0 million for the three months ended June 30, 2015 (exclusive of $0.1 million of advisory and legal costs related to acquisitions) compared to Adjusted EBITDA of $43.1 million for the three months ended June 30, 2014 (exclusive of $1.1 million of advisory and legal costs related to acquisitions and $2.7 million of compensation costs related to the Gavilon acquisition).
